摘 要:目的探讨扩散加权成像(DWI)表观扩散系数(ADC)值对非透明细胞肾癌亚型的鉴别诊断价值。资料与方法经手术病理证实的48例非透明细胞肾癌患者,术前行DWI检查(b=0、800s/mm2)测定病变ADC值,比较不同亚型非透明细胞肾癌ADC值的差异。结果 48例共48个病灶,直径(3.8±2.3)cm,其中肾嫌色细胞癌(CRCC)20例,乳头状肾细胞癌(PRCC)28例(Ⅰ型18例,Ⅱ型10例)。CRCC的ADC值为(0.994±0.184)×10-3mm2/s,PRCC的ADC值为(0.860±0.114)×10-3mm2/s,差异有统计学意义(P<0.01);PRCCⅠ型ADC值为(0.908±0.085)×10-3mm2/s,Ⅱ型ADC值为(0.775±0.113)×10-3mm2/s,差异有统计学意义(P<0.01);CRCC和PRCCⅡ型ADC值差异有统计学意义(P<0.01),CRCC和PRCCⅠ型ADC值差异无统计学意义(P>0.05)。结论当b=800s/mm2时,ADC值可以鉴别CRCC和PRCCⅡ型,但不能鉴别PRCCⅠ型和CRCC。ADC值对鉴别非透明细胞肾癌亚型有一定帮助,但鉴别诊断效能不高。Purpose To investigate the significance of apparent diffusion coefficient (ADC) in differential diagnosis of non-clear cell renal cell carcinoma. Materials and Methods Forty-eight patients with pathology-proven non-clear cell renal cell carcinoma underwent preoperative diffusion weighted imaging (b=0, 800 s/mm 2 ). The ADC values in different subtypes were analyzed. Results There were 48 lesions in 48 patients with average tumor size of (3.8±2.3) cm, including 20 chromophobe cell renal cell carcinoma (CRCC) and 28 papillary renal cell carcinoma (PRCC) (18 typeⅠ, 10 typeⅡ). The ADC was (0.994±0.184)×10 -3 mm 2 /s for CRCC, and (0.860±0.114)×10 -3 mm 2 /s for PRCC with statistical significance (P&lt;0.01). The ADC for type Ⅰ PRCC was (0.908±0.085)×10 -3 mm 2 /s and (0.775±0.113)×10 -3 mm 2 /s for type Ⅱ PRCC with statistical significance (P&lt;0.01). The ADC for CRCC was not significantly different from type Ⅰ PRCC (P&gt;0.05). Conclusion When b=800 s/mm 2 , ADC is useful in differentiate certain subtypes of non-clear cell renal cell carcinoma.
